Transaction e7521e8b62f004ede3365eeca0cc634b3fde180e2a591dde074d2b76e21b62a5

1 Input
2 Outputs
  • e7521e8b62f004ede3365eeca0cc634b3fde180e2a591dde074d2b76e21b62a5:0
  • value  1520000
    address  3BMEXsuzWj19vPRpwYXMAA5Auv8fuV5qu3
  • e7521e8b62f004ede3365eeca0cc634b3fde180e2a591dde074d2b76e21b62a5:1
  • value  5591128
    address  bc1qlfm2kywf5vaw6vwtpn7herharqxk6zar2cfee9